Insider Stakes: The Growth Titans Betting Big on Their Own Success in 2025
Companies
2025-02-18 11:02:30Content

As the financial landscape unfolds in early 2025, the U.S. stock market is radiating an infectious sense of optimism. Major market indices, including the S&P 500, are tantalizingly close to breaking record highs, with weekly gains painting a picture of economic resilience and investor confidence.
In this buoyant market climate, savvy investors are turning their attention to growth companies characterized by significant insider ownership. These strategic investments offer a compelling proposition: when company leadership holds substantial stakes, their financial interests become intrinsically linked with shareholder success. This alignment creates a powerful incentive for management to drive performance, innovate, and generate sustainable value.
The current market momentum suggests that companies with strong insider ownership might be particularly well-positioned to capitalize on emerging opportunities. By closely monitoring these firms, investors can potentially tap into a strategy that combines strategic leadership, financial commitment, and growth potential.
Navigating the Investment Landscape: Insider Ownership and Market Dynamics in 2025
The financial ecosystem of 2025 presents a complex and dynamic environment for investors, where strategic decision-making and nuanced understanding of market trends can unlock unprecedented opportunities for wealth generation and portfolio optimization.Unlock Your Financial Potential: Smart Investing Strategies Revealed
The Evolving Paradigm of Stock Market Performance
The contemporary investment landscape is characterized by unprecedented volatility and transformative market dynamics. Sophisticated investors are increasingly recognizing that traditional metrics alone cannot capture the intricate nuances of financial performance. The interplay between corporate governance, management alignment, and shareholder value has become a critical focal point for discerning investment strategies. Modern financial analysts are delving deeper into organizational structures, examining how leadership compensation and equity stakes correlate with long-term corporate performance. This holistic approach transcends simplistic numerical analysis, offering a more comprehensive understanding of potential investment opportunities.Insider Ownership: A Strategic Investment Indicator
Insider ownership represents a sophisticated mechanism for aligning management's financial interests with broader shareholder objectives. When corporate executives maintain substantial equity stakes, it signals a profound commitment to organizational success and sustainable growth strategies. Empirical research suggests that companies with significant insider ownership often demonstrate more disciplined financial management, reduced agency costs, and enhanced strategic decision-making. These organizations tend to prioritize long-term value creation over short-term financial manipulations, presenting an attractive proposition for investors seeking stable and predictable returns.Market Sentiment and Investor Confidence in 2025
The current market environment reflects a nuanced interplay of technological innovation, global economic recalibration, and evolving investor psychology. Major indices like the S&P 500 are experiencing remarkable resilience, indicating a robust underlying economic foundation and growing investor confidence. Technological disruption, geopolitical realignments, and emerging economic models are reshaping traditional investment paradigms. Investors must remain agile, continuously adapting their strategies to navigate these complex and interconnected global financial systems.Strategic Investment Approaches for Discerning Investors
Successful investment strategies in 2025 demand a multifaceted approach that integrates quantitative analysis with qualitative insights. Investors should focus on companies demonstrating strong governance structures, transparent management practices, and a clear alignment between executive compensation and shareholder value. Comprehensive due diligence involves examining not just financial statements, but also understanding corporate culture, leadership vision, and potential for sustainable growth. This holistic evaluation enables investors to identify organizations with genuine potential for long-term value creation.Technological Integration and Investment Intelligence
Advanced data analytics and artificial intelligence are revolutionizing investment research, providing unprecedented insights into market trends and corporate performance. Machine learning algorithms can now process vast amounts of financial data, identifying subtle patterns and potential investment opportunities that might escape traditional human analysis. Investors leveraging these technological tools can develop more sophisticated, data-driven investment strategies, gaining a competitive edge in an increasingly complex financial landscape.RELATED NEWS
Companies

Playtime Casualties: How Trump's Trade War Is Crushing America's Toy Industry
2025-03-03 16:54:44
Companies

Massive Legal Blows: US Corporations Slammed with $40 Billion in 'Nuclear Verdicts'
2025-03-02 09:07:38